The problem is that you cannot "catch" BV and nor can it be passed from person to person.
This condition is caused by an imbalance of the naturally occurring bacteria within the vagina. This can happen for many reasons, both internal and external, with some of the more common causes being:-
* Over-washing
* A change of sexual partner
* Douching
* Wearing tight underpants
* Using perfumed products around the vaginal area
* Eating a poor diet, lacking protective nutrients
* Smoking
As you can see, the causes are varied and the problem with conventional treatment is that it only treats the symptoms and not these, or any of the other common causes. Although not harmful in its early stages, if bacterial vaginosis is left untreated it can lead to pelvic inflammatory disease and can even render some women infertile. Therefore, it is always a good idea to treat the condition promptly. You are particularly at risk if you get repeated attacks.
